Culture Squared


Our ability to pass non-genetic information, such as culture, to our descendants, is the genetic advancement which sets us apart from other animals. We call all non-genetically inherited human phenomena,  culture.

Our evolution is no longer dependent on random mutations in our DNA. Evolutionary principles also govern our collective ideas, cultures, sciences and faiths. Advancements in science have the potential to make our descendants unrecognisable to our ancestors. Our knowledge and experiences, correct or otherwise are being dictated to the world wide web, a virtual and actual brain of our cyborg collective.

What further advancement in information inheritance would a future species require, to be comparably superior to us?

I believe that ultimately, our descendants will be hard-wired into the knowledge bank that is the collective human experience, soon after birth, maybe even prenatally. If regulated on egalitarian principles then each of our descendants will be bestowed the entire recorded knowledge of humanity. We will access, learn from and in turn enrich this database with our own experiences.  If regulated on current capitalist principles then knowledge will be traded for experience or physical labour.

The evolution of this symbiosis  or "culture squared" has already overtaken our genetic change over time and will continue to do so at a hyperbolic rate.
